Abstract

A complete metric space of function-valued mappings appropriate for the representation of hyperspectral images is introduced. A class of fractal transforms is then formulated on this space. Under certain conditions, the fractal transform T can be contractive, implying the existence of a unique fixed point. We then formulate a simple class of block transforms for the fractal coding of digital hyperspectral images, and illustrate with an example.
